Transaction 8debd39c8f1c0b260ee99907ecde485ad7a30ade097d3c7d7cc595696da6c026

1 Input
2 Outputs
  • 8debd39c8f1c0b260ee99907ecde485ad7a30ade097d3c7d7cc595696da6c026:0
  • value  761400
    address  3EiFp11PsEp9oEHUQuL8HuJKeaA9QPvdJK
  • 8debd39c8f1c0b260ee99907ecde485ad7a30ade097d3c7d7cc595696da6c026:1
  • value  42795164
    address  bc1qs8dvtxszvz0ef4rrgkmen2jjlqeyfkplg7hpxku3wmw52fd6a2msxaygj6